Undergraduate music scholarship auditions for the University of the Cumberlands 2007-08 school year has been set for March 24. The University of the Cumberlands is a private, liberal-arts school with a pretty generous endowment for music students. We're in a great situation right now because our administration really wants to beef up the size of our instrumental music program, so they've just increased scholarship amounts.
We offer marching band, concert band, tuba euphonium ensemble, jazz band, brass quintets and trombone choir.
The school is located right on I-75 in Williamsburg, Kentucky- About 11 miles from the Tennessee border, halfway between Lexington and Knoxville.
